Ultimately goal of initiation is to get ribosome to initiator aug met. The initiator trna is different then average trna. The actual initiation is broken into 4 steps (5 if including charging trna) Each step is moving from 1 complex to another get bigger. All of initiation basically occurs with small subunit then large subunit comes in. Small subunit is where mrna is bound and where there is recognition of codon and anticodon of trna trna met aa (charged got met and gtp) and initiation factor. Eif eukaryotic initiation factor, later it becomes eef elongation factor. Ternary complex is basically charged trna and initiation factor this ternary binds small subunit. Now adds 2 initiation factors (4g, 4e)
